[PATCH] qemu: ppc: kvm-userspace: KVM PowerPC support for qemu gdbstub
From: Hollis Blanchard <hollisb@xxxxxxxxxx>
Add basic KVM PowerPC support to qemu's gdbstub introducing a kvm ppc style
mmu implementation that uses the kvm_translate ioctl.
This also requires to save the kvm registers prior to the 'm' gdb operations.

+int mmukvm_get_physical_address(CPUState *env, mmu_ctx_t *ctx,
+ target_ulong eaddr, int rw, int access_type)
+{
+ struct kvm_translation tr;
+ uint64_t pid;
+ uint64_t as;
+ int r;
+
+ pid = env->spr[SPR_BOOKE_PID];
+
+ if (access_type == ACCESS_CODE)
+ as = env->msr & msr_ir;
+ else
+ as = env->msr & msr_dr;
+
+ tr.linear_address = as << 40 | pid << 32 | eaddr;
+ r = kvm_translate(kvm_context, env->cpu_index, &tr);
+ if (r == -1)
+ return r;
+
+ if (!tr.valid)
+ return -EFAULT;
+
+ ctx->raddr = tr.physical_address;
+ return 0;
+}
